When | Why |
---|---|
Dec-01-19 | Zadatak za vežbu |
Dec-01-19 | Zadatak za vežbu-rešenje |
Kreiranje formulara i formi
Etikete koje su do sada razmatrane
omogućavaju samo da se oformi hipertekstuelni dokument koji će se razgledati navigatorom. Ali navigator može i da prenese podatke ka web-serveru da bi se ti podaci tamo obradili. Ova mogućnost se ostvaruje preko koncepta formulara (ili obrasca, engl. form). Formular dopušta da se razvije sumeđa (eng. interface) između korisnika i servera: korisnik popunjava formular i šalje ga ka serveru. Polazeći od podataka iz formulara vrši se odgovarajuća obrada na serveru, a o rezultatima korisnik eventualno biva obavešten. Obaveštavanje se ostvaruje tako što server generiše dokument u HTML-u koristeći se informacijama iz formulara i vraća ga korisniku preko navigatora ili preko e-pošte. Osnovna razlika između razgledanja neke strane i formulara se ogleda u tome što je za "običnu" hpertekstuelnu stranu dovoljno "kliknuti" na hiper-vezu sa adresom x da bi se prešlo sa tekućeg na dokument na adresi x dok se kod formulara uspostavlja veza sa adresom x nekog programa na serveru. Preko formulara mogu se ostvariti različite aplikacije kao što su:
Formular se implementira preko etikete čiji je opšti oblik:
...
Etiketa sadrži dva atributa:
U okviru etikete mogu se navesti i druge etikete koje opisuju, na primer, izgled polja za unos podataka u formularu, izgled polja za "štrikliranje", i sl. Etikete se ne mogu umetati jedna u drugu. Zajednički atributi različitih etiketa su name, kojim se definiše ime promenljive preko koje će biti izvršena dodela vrednosti, i value, koja predstavlja ili izabranu vrednost u formularu ili tekst koji će biti prikazan (videti donje primere).
Etikete unutar formulara su:
Top of Form
Bottom of Form
Top of Form
Bottom of Form
Top of Form
Koje programske jezike poznajete?
Bottom of Form
Top of Form
Imate li vlastiti računar?
Top of Form
Vaše ime i prezime?
Bottom of Form
Top of Form
Vaša fotografija?
Bottom of Form
Top of Form
Vaša lozinka?
Bottom of Form
META tagovi:
Meta tagovi predstavljaju skrivene html tagove, što znači da ih ne mogu videti posetioci web strane. Čemu onda služe META tagovi? Nalaze se u okviru HEAD elementa (tag-a) i imaju ulogu da internet pretraživačima (poput Google-a, Yahoo-a, Bing-a itd...) daju bliže informacije o posmatranom web sajtu ili konkretnoj web stranici.
Primer 1. "Naivni" upitnik za prijavljivanje ispita.
Moj omiljen predmet na 1. godini je:
Top of Form
Bottom of Form
Primer 2. Atributi SIZE i MULTIPLE etikete SELECT.
ime rows=n cols=m> ... neki tekst ...
Title Tag je veoma značajan i važan tag i u njemu se nalazi naslov vaše strane. Bez obzira što TITLE Tag nije meta tag, mislim da bi trebalo opisati njegov značaj i upotrebu.. Pravilno korišćenje ovog taga vam može poboljšati pozicije u pretrazivačima. Preporučujem da se u title tag ne stavlja preko 15 reči i da se najbitnije reči stave na početak. Ovde treba biti vrlo pažljiv jer morate imati u vidu da nisu samo pretraživači ti koji ce videti ovaj tag - sve što se u njemu nalazi videće se kao naslov u vrhu brauzera i ukoliko neko doda vaš sajt u "Favorites" ili "Bookmarks", to ce biti reči koje će da opisuju vašu stranu. Da sumiram: za title tag je najbolje staviti razuman i kratak naslov ali pokušati što je moguće više prirodnije da bitnije reči budu na pocetku ili što bliže.
Primer:
Ukoliko vas interesuju meta tagovi, kako se koriste i sl. koje bi ste reci prvo ukucali u pretraživac da to nadete? Mislim da sam u ovom primeru pogodio koje bi ste reči najverovatnije ukucali u pretraživač. Upravo je to način kako pravilno koristiti title tag ;)
Description META Tag je tag u kojem se nalazi glavni opis sadržaja vaše strane. Ovaj tag podržavaju svi pretraživači ali najviše ga upotrebljavaju AltaVista, AllTheWeb i Teoma. Google i Yahoo ga ponekad koriste ali uglavnom sami kreiraju svoj opis koji kupe sa web strane ili kupe podatke iz direktorijuma: DMOZ-a(Google) i Overture-a(Yahoo).
Mislim da je ovaj tag potrebno imati ali treba voditi računa da se u ovom tagu ne nalazi više od 200 karaktera. Preterivanje u ovom tagu nekada može dovesti do toga da vas neki pretraživači mogu početi smatrati za "spam sajt" čime bi vaše pozicije znatno opale; nekad vas zbog velikog preterivanja mogu čak i skroz izbrisati iz svog index-a. Ovo važi i za druge tagove - moj najbolji savet je: NE PRETERIVATI!
Primer:
>
Keywords META Tag predstavlja seriju ključnih fraza koje se nalaze na vašem sajtu. Ovde možete staviti sve specifične fraze koje reprezentuju vaš sajt ali ih treba uskladiti tako da to budu i reči koje bi neko ukucao u pretraživac ukoliko želi da pronađe informacije koje sadrži vaš sajt. Vrlo je bitna stvar da se ovde ne stavljaju reči koje se ne nalaze na vašoj strani - znaci smisaono i prirodno prilagodite sadržaj vaše strane tako da sadrži fraze koje bi neko ukucao u pretraživac ukoliko traži ono što vi nudite (stavite se na mesto korisnika: Šta bi ste vi ukucali da nadete ono što vaš sajt nudi?) . Upravo te fraze treba da postoje u ovom tagu. Preporučljivo je da u ovom tagu ne bude više od 250 karaktera; ovaj tag ne podržavaju Google, AllTheWeb i AltaVista, dok ga Tehoma I Yahoo podržavaju. Ja lično koristim ovaj tag zbog Yahoo-a i ukoliko su vam pozicije na Yahoo-u bitne koristite ovaj tag. Treba naglasiti da ovi tagovi iz dana u dan sve više gube vrednost i znacaj u optimizaciji sajtova i da ih danas i ne morate implementirati zarad pozicija u glavnim pretraživacima (oni su uveliko počeli ignorisati ovaj tag zbog njegove zloupotrebe i preterivanja u broju fraza) - njihov algoritam pretraživanja je daleko evoluirao, ali neki manji pretraživaci ih i dalje koriste i daju im značaj tako da ne škodi da se koriste.
Primer:
>
Language META Tag definiše jezik na kojem je vaš sajt. Ovaj tag je potreban nekim meta pretraživačima prilikom klasifikacije vašeg sajta po jeziku tako da ga nije loše imati pogotovo ako submitujete vaš sajt automatski u više pretraživača.
Primer:
1
Added December 01, 2019 at 11:43am
by Nastavnik Govedarica
Title: Zadatak za vežbu
SAMOSTALNI RAD
Added December 01, 2019 at 11:43am
by Nastavnik Govedarica
Title: Zadatak za vežbu-rešenje
file:///C:/Users/Janja/Desktop/TESTOVI/AS2%20Test%202/test1/resenje1a/kviz.html
Logging in, please wait...
0 General Document comments
0 Sentence and Paragraph comments
0 Image and Video comments
Unutar etikete INPUT može de dodavati tip koji određuje iygled forme
New Conversation
Hide Full Comment
Da bi postojala mogučnost selektivnog izbora neophodno je da se prilikom kreiranja ovog formulara u etiketi navedu iste oynake za NAME a različite za VALUE
New Conversation
Hide Full Comment
Ukoliko defišemo formu kao polje za unos podataka , potrebno je odrediti i veličinu tj.dužinu forme .Dužina se određuje sa atributom SIZE,a podrazumevani tekst u formi sa VALUE
New Conversation
Hide Full Comment
Prilikom kreiranja polja za unos teksta -TEXTAREA ne upisuje se etiketa INPUT ,a veličina polja se određuje definisanjem redova i kolona.
New Conversation
Hide Full Comment
svi pomenute forme su ovde prikazane.Da li ima pitanja?
New Conversation
Hide Full Comment
New Conversation
General Document Comments 0